We're in the process of planning a group cruise for next March on the Pride of Aloha. So far we've got 5 couples going with a few more people on the fence. Can you make reservations at the main dining rooms on NCL just to ensure that our large group can sit together (or at least at a couple of tables next to each other)?

The operation of a diningroom on a Freestyle ship is very much like a large restaurant on land. If you show up at the door with a party of 10 or larger, they may not be able to take you right away. But if you call ahead or speak to the diningroom manager in advance, there is usually no problem at all. When you get aboard the ship, ask for the F&B Director or REstaurant Manager. Tell him what you have planned. He can assist you in making it a special occasion.

We had a couple of large CC gatherings for dinner 12+ people on the Sky, and had no problem working through the concierge to get things set up. It is not an issue if you give some notice. As well if you have a favorite waiter, which by then enough of us will have sailed her that we can offer some recommends you can ask for that person as well. It actually is far more flexible than traditional cruising. You just have to know how it works and then make it work for you. My experience with NCL, after 6 cruises is that "NO" is not a word they like to use very often.
